Method

Cubano Viejo Directions

  1. 1

    Prepare the Glass

    Chill a cocktail glass by filling it with ice water. Set aside while you prepare the drink.

  2. 2

    Muddle the Mint

    In a cocktail shaker, add the fresh mint leaves. Using a muddler, gently press the mint to release its essential oils. Be careful not to tear the leaves too much.

  3. 3

    Add the Ingredients

    To the cocktail shaker with the muddled mint, add the white rum, fresh lime juice, dry vermouth, and simple syrup. Fill the shaker with ice.

  4. 4

    Shake the Mixture

    Secure the lid on the cocktail shaker and shake vigorously for about 15-20 seconds, until well chilled.

  5. 5

    Strain into Glass

    Remove the ice water from the chilled cocktail glass. Using a fine mesh strainer, pour the cocktail mixture into the glass, leaving the mint leaves behind.

  6. 6

    Top with Cava

    Slowly pour the cava over the cocktail to top it off. This will add a refreshing fizz to your drink.

  7. 7

    Garnish

    Garnish the cocktail with a lime wheel and a sprig of mint for an aromatic touch.

  8. 8

    Serve

    Serve immediately and enjoy your refreshing Cubano Viejo!
